ZIP 57072 and ZIP 57078 are ZIP Code areas in South Dakota.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 57078 has the higher population (20,547 vs 547 in ZIP 57072). ZIP 57072 has the higher median household income ($77,143 vs $72,395 in ZIP 57078). ZIP 57078 has the higher median home value ($213,300 vs $181,600 in ZIP 57072).
